Is RPA a strategic priority in your organization?<\/h6>\n<p>RPA must be a business priority in your organization. Its adoption is a top-down process, championed by an organization\u2019s leadership team. Start organization-wide conversations with all teams (be it finance, HR, IT, marketing or customer services) early. Address the following at this initial stage: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>RPA evangelism<\/strong> \u2013 Identify the RPA evangelists in each team. What will be their responsibilities as you make this transition and how can you help them in their roles?<\/li>\n<li><strong>A communications strategy<\/strong> \u2013 RPA is associated with many misconceptions and it is important to reassure everyone in your team about their job security. If there is hesitancy within the team, this is the perfect time to listen to their concerns.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Knowledge transfer and training plan<\/strong> \u2013 Bots will not replace all tasks. In the post-bot phase, is your team properly equipped to concentrate on the other tasks that they will now focus on?<\/li>\n<li><strong>Possible problems<\/strong> \u2013 One of the advantages of early consultations is to gain a thorough understanding of issues and risks that may arise with RPA. Plan for contingencies, where possible.<\/li>\n<li><strong>A change in culture<\/strong> \u2013 Adopting RPA often results in the change of an organization\u2019s culture. Is everyone, from the leadership team to junior employees, ready for the change?<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h6>2. Are your business processes fully documented and optimized?<\/h6>\n<p>The role of RPA is not to redesign your processes, it only automates it. While the goal of RPA is to optimize processes, a poorly performing and overly complex process riddled with operational inefficiencies and unnecessary steps that don\u2019t add value will see very little benefit from RPA.To harness the full benefits of an RPA implementation, businesses must ensure that they have made a solid effort to improve the process by taking a second look at outdated standard operating procedures. Applying RPA to an inefficient process means that you also automate inefficiencies so start off by identifying process defects, gaps, and underutilized resources.<\/p>\n<p>Ensure you have comprehensive workflow knowledge. Map out the entire process, with its bottlenecks and complications. Your workflows must be as frictionless as possible before you introduce RPA.<br \/>Review the processes to ensure that it is fully digitized with standard readable electronic inputs such as Excel, Word, email, XML, PPT, readable PDFs, web service payloads. If there are non-digitized inputs involved in the process, leverage AI-powered technologies like intelligent Optical Character Recognition (OCR) to scan data, digitize it, and structure data that is not structured or digitized.<\/p>\n<h6>3. Is the selected process the best candidate for RPA?<\/h6>\n<p>Candidates for automation must be evaluated with the right criteria. Look at urgent business need, specific business cases, and low-hanging fruit. Think about your business needs and automate the right tasks. What are the tedious, routine, and mundane tasks that are also time consuming? Examples include file management, responding to the same customer queries repeatedly, time recording, raising orders, collecting data, etc. These are often best served by bots.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Employee Involvement<\/strong> \u2013 Does the process require high attention to detail? Does it require high levels of employee involvement to do mundane work? If you answered yes, RPA might be the route to ensure these tasks are executed quickly and accurately, while releasing valuable FTEs to work on more value-adding, strategic activities.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Volume &amp; Frequency of Processes<\/strong> \u2013 Ask yourself: What is the frequency and volume of the selected process? Look for high transaction volume processes as well as processes that recur on a daily or weekly frequency basis as these often involve a lot of manual work and are prone to human error.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Process Complexity<\/strong> \u2013 Dive deep to understand the complexity of the chosen process: What are the total number of steps in the process? Are there many applications to be interfaced? Are there multiple channels involved? Are several complex datasets processed as part of the process<\/li>\n<li><strong>Rule-based Processes<\/strong> \u2013 Do the chosen processes have clear processing instructions, with decision-making based on standardized and predictive rules? If your process does follow \u201cif this, then that\u201d rules, it is an ideal candidate for automation. However, RPA enhanced with AI (Intelligent Automation), can help you go beyond these rules-based limitations of RPA and offers endless possibilities of potential tasks and processes to automate.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h6>4. Have you identified success criteria and KPIs to measure the impact of RPA?<\/h6>\n<p>As success can be very context-specific, performing a cost-benefit analysis that considers all aspects of your business operations is a must for organizations before formulating an RPA strategy. To ensure that you are getting the best possible return on investment, focus on the following: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Background research<\/strong> \u2013 There are many case studies on successful RPA implementations. Study them to understand what exact factors facilitated success.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Define success<\/strong> \u2013 Defining business success includes considering your unique business goals. What is your organization\u2019s definition of a successful RPA strategy, incorporating both tangible and intangible factors<\/li>\n<li><strong>Alignment of RPA strategy with business goals<\/strong> \u2013 Identify what you want to achieve in the immediate aftermath, in the medium term, and for the long term after introducing RPA.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Sustainability<\/strong> \u2013 Is your RPA strategy financially sustainable in the long term? Understand what\u2019s possible with your organization\u2019s budget.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h6>5. Are your RPA goals aligned with the expectations of all business stakeholders?<\/h6>\n<p>Implementing any new technology requires stakeholder buy-in at different levels across the enterprise \u2013 from the executive suite and the employees to external stakeholders such as customers and partners. It is not uncommon for conflicting views to emerge. On one hand, in-house tech teams may be wary of new technologies such as RPA as they may worry about rolling out new solutions while also managing existing, under-utilized technologies. On the other hand, employees may view RPA as a threat to their jobs. It is, therefore, necessary to actively engage stakeholders across the organization and address legitimate concerns related to visibility, access, controls, support, and management of the RPA environment and software bots. The organization must also clearly communicate the benefits of RPA to get by-in, and bridge knowledge gaps by training employees in the skills needed to fulfill their new, bot-powered roles.<\/p>\n<h6>6. Is RPA compatible with the existing underlying tech architecture and infrastructure? Do you have data governance structures in place?<\/h6>\n<p>RPA cannot compensate for outdated IT infrastructures so the business should work in close collaboration with the internal IT team and RPA consultants to build an RPA roadmap to ensure integration problems with existing systems do not arise.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>A data security strategy<\/strong> \u2013 Bots are used to collect, store, and transfer data. It is extremely important that your team members in charge of data related functions are adequately trained. Do you have the in-house expertise to deal with data security or will you have to look outside for training?<\/li>\n<li><strong>The right infrastructure<\/strong> \u2013 Legacy infrastructure may not be the best base for RPA. Can you integrate RPA tools securely with your existing infrastructure? Or do you have to re-architect your existing infrastructure?<\/li>\n<li><strong>Data governance<\/strong> \u2013 A key area that enterprises cannot afford to overlook during an RPA implementation. A centralized control and a robust governance framework that clearly outlines the structures, accountability mechanisms, rules-of-engagement, roles &amp; responsibilities, data access, security and processes to manage and control RPA activities is essential to realize the full benefits from technology.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>A \u2018business-led\u2019 only implementation approach of RPA that does not integrate seamlessly with the wider IT infrastructure could put the implementation at risk. Inclusion of the organization\u2019s DevOps team can help the business consider both technical and practical objectives when formulating the RPA strategy to ensure that enterprise is well-equipped to harness the full potential of RPA through scripts, bots and APIs.<\/p>\n<h6>RPA Readiness: Choosing the right technology partner<\/h6>\n<p>RPA success does not merely depend on the technology alone \u2013 but it is also about the capabilities of the technology partner you select.
